:: adgruntie :: TVs get gender specific in Sony ads

+ Slate gives Sony's new ads a C-. I'm not sure if they even deserve that high of a grade. The whole "The first television for men and women" tagline is just inane and has irked me since it began running. So only men care about the technical aspects and only women care about how it looks? Please. Seriously, have you ever heard of a gender specific tv? It's like they took the stats from the brief and just shoehorned them into the creative. The whole idea of what makes it for a man and woman is also never really explained or explored in the ads either. Falls flat really. The spots are directed well but that's about it.
